Transaction 160afaa9b21152bacbdd58e6f40d274356eb569a6bb1081c9f8c36d6c0f479c4
1 Input
1 Output
-
160afaa9b21152bacbdd58e6f40d274356eb569a6bb1081c9f8c36d6c0f479c4:0
- value
- 1604437
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dacbde0b6198fa91b7539570c69d759f5b989f1 OP_EQUAL
- address
- 3Ec88twKM2WAz4AuNxtyTyzsxULrgn8jrd